Installation Notes and Tips
Verify the vehicle’s year, model, and starter configuration before installation. Confirm clockwise rotation, 11 pinion teeth, closed nose design, and 12V electrical requirements match the original unit. Check battery condition, cable integrity, and charging system output during diagnosis so the replacement starter is installed into a properly serviced starting circuit.
